免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

微信开发工具怎么制作小程序

微信开发工具是微信官方推出的一款小程序开发工具,它能够帮助开发者进行小程序的开发、调试、预览和发布,具有非常强大的功能。下面就来详细介绍一下微信开发工具如何制作小程序。

1. 下载并安装微信开发工具

首先我们需要在官网上下载微信开发工具,安装后打开软件,点击新建项目,输入项目名称、项目所在目录、AppID和项目描述等相关信息,点击确定即可创建一个新的小程序项目。

2. 项目结构介绍

微信开发工具会自动生成一些默认的文件和文件夹,主要包括app.json、pages/index/index.js、pages/index/index.wxml、pages/index/index.wxss等文件。其中,app.json是小程序的配置文件,用于配置小程序的全局属性;pages文件夹用于存放小程序的页面文件;index.js、index.wxml、index.wxss用于定义index页面的逻辑、结构和样式。

3. 页面设计

通过微信开发工具,我们可以使用类似HTML的标记语言WXML来设计小程序的页面结构,使用WXSS来定义页面的样式,使用JavaScript来实现页面的逻辑。在页面设计时,需要注意WXML中的标记语言符号和HTML有些不同,如在标签属性中用{{}}来绑定数据。

4. 数据交互

小程序可以使用网络请求的方式来获取服务器中的数据,可以使用wx.request()函数来实现数据的异步请求。同时,微信提供了了wx.showToast()、wx.showLoading()等函数来实现消息提示和加载动画。在小程序的生命周期中,还可以使用onLoad()、onReady()、onShow()、onHide()、onUnload()等各个生命周期函数来实现各种不同的功能。

5. 调试和发布

在页面设计和实现完毕后,我们可以通过微信开发工具进行预览和调试。在微信开发工具中,可以通过“预览”按钮来预览小程序,如果有错误会在控制台中给出相应的错误提示。如果没有问题,我们可以将小程序提交到微信公众平台进行审核和发布。

通过以上步骤,我们可以使用微信开发工具快速、简单地实现小程序的开发和发布。需要注意的是,在开发过程中要严格遵守微信小程序开发规范,保证小程序的质量和安全性。


相关知识:
百度小程序代开发
百度小程序是一种基于百度开放平台的轻量级应用,它可以在百度的搜索结果中直接打开,无需下载安装,能够提供丰富的功能和服务。本文将介绍百度小程序的代开发原理和详细过程。一、百度小程序的代开发原理百度小程序代开发是指第三方开发者代替品牌或企业进行小程序的开发和维
2023-08-23
安徽小程序开发教程
安徽小程序开发教程小程序是一种类似于APP的应用程序,可以在微信中使用。小程序最大的特点就是轻量级、易推广、不需要下载安装就能直接使用,用户体验较好。安徽小程序开发需要掌握以下知识:一、小程序的开发工具1、微信开发者工具微信开发者工具是小程序的开发必备工具
2023-08-09
安卓应用开发与微信小程序开发
安卓应用开发:安卓应用开发是指开发在安卓操作系统上的移动应用程序。安卓应用可以是普通的应用程序,也可以是针对特定设备的应用程序,如手机、平板电脑、智能电视、汽车等。安卓开发工具Android Studio是由谷歌提供的最新的安卓开发工具,开发安卓应用程序时
2023-08-09
wifi扫码小程序开发多少钱啊
WIFI扫码小程序是一种智能化的网络工具,能够通过扫描二维码连接WIFI,无需手动输入密码,这项功能越来越受到用户的欢迎,因此,它的开发也备受关注。但是,WIFI扫码小程序的开发价格并不固定,通常会根据开发者经验、技术水平、项目复杂度等因素而定。WIFI扫
2023-08-09
swiftui开发微信小程序
SwiftUI是Swift语言的UI编程框架,是一种声明性编程方式,让用户能够以更少的代码实现更好的UI效果,它是针对iOS、macOS、watchOS和tvOS平台的。而微信小程序是微信生态中的一种轻应用,运行在微信平台,不需要下载或安装,即可使用。那么
2023-08-09
php小程序开发小程序码
PHP小程序开发小程序码是一种将PHP与微信小程序结合起来的技术,主要用于生成小程序码。小程序码是微信小程序的一个重要组成部分,用于识别不同的小程序。在小程序开发中,小程序码通常被应用于小程序的推广和分享等功能中。下面是小编对PHP小程序开发小程序码的原理
2023-08-09
jdk开发工具包小程序
JDK (Java Development Kit) 是Java平台的基础开发工具包,它包含了JRE (Java Runtime Environment) 和一系列开发工具,比如编译器(javac)、JavaDoc、JAR、运行时间工具(jconsole)
2023-08-09
github 微信小程序开发教务系统
近年来,微信小程序的发展迅速,成为了一个新的互联网产业。微信小程序不仅能够为用户提供便捷的服务,也为开发者带来了更多的机会。而作为开发者,要想在微信小程序开发领域获得更多的利益,就要掌握相关的技术和知识。本文将详细介绍如何使用 Github 进行微信小程序
2023-08-09
goland生成exe文件
Goland是由JetBrains开发的一款专门用于Go语言开发的IDE(集成开发环境)。Goland提供了非常便捷的工程管理、自动补全、代码提示、代码格式化、调试等功能,让Go语言开发变得更加高效。 在本教程中,我们将探讨如何使用Goland生成exe文
2023-05-26
信小程序开发工具承诺守信
信小程序开发工具是一款功能强大、易于上手的小程序开发工具,旨在为开发者提供优质的开发体验和稳定的服务。信小程序开发工具的背后有着强大的技术支持和严格的安全保障,与此同时,信小程序开发工具也秉承着守信经营的理念,在服务中承诺守信。信小程序开发工具守信的原理主
2023-05-26
微信小程序开发工具能离线开发吗
随着微信小程序的出现,越来越多的开发者想要尝试开发小程序。微信小程序开发工具是一款官方的集成开发环境,提供了可视化界面编辑和代码编辑功能,让开发者快速开发和调试应用程序。但是,有些开发者可能会遇到没有网络连接的情况,想要进行离线开发。那么,微信小程序开发工
2023-05-26
燃气设备小程序开发工具下载
燃气设备小程序开发是指基于微信小程序平台的燃气设备管理系统,它能够实现燃气设备的在线监控、故障诊断、运行维护等功能。为了方便开发者使用微信小程序进行开发,微信官方提供了一个免费的小程序开发工具,以下是详细介绍:一、开发工具下载微信小程序开发工具可以在微信公
2023-05-26